Are there any alternatives to PhoenixMiner for mining cryptocurrencies?
I'm looking for alternative mining software to PhoenixMiner for cryptocurrencies. Can anyone recommend any other options? I want to explore different options and see if there are any better alternatives out there. Any suggestions?
3 answers
- Simon ElijahDec 18, 2025 · 4 months agoSure, there are several alternatives to PhoenixMiner for mining cryptocurrencies. One popular option is Claymore Miner, which offers similar features and has been widely used in the crypto mining community. Another alternative is CGMiner, a powerful and customizable mining software that supports various cryptocurrencies. Additionally, you can consider Ethminer, which is specifically designed for Ethereum mining. These alternatives provide different features and performance, so it's worth trying them out to see which one suits your needs the best.
- JustTryingToLearnJan 27, 2025 · a year agoDefinitely! If you're looking for an alternative to PhoenixMiner, you can try out Bminer. It's known for its high efficiency and stability, and it supports multiple algorithms, making it suitable for mining various cryptocurrencies. Another option is XMRig, which is specifically designed for mining Monero. It's open-source and offers good performance. Remember to do your own research and compare the features and performance of different mining software before making a decision.
